Genome Screening for Susceptibility Loci in Systemic Lupus Erythematosus
American Journal of PharmacoGenomics, 2002Systemic lupus erythematosus (SLE) is a complex, multigenic autoimmune disease with a wide spectrum of clinical manifestations. Much of the pathology is attributed to deposition to various tissues of immune complexes continuously formed with autoantibodies; thus, the pathogenesis is related to dysregulation of self-reactive B cells.

Genome-wide studies of psoriasis susceptibility loci: a review
Journal of Dermatological Science, 2004Psoriasis is a chronic inflammatory dermatosis affecting approximately 0.3-5% world-wide. Since 1997, nine genome-wide scans have been published in the search for predisposing genes to psoriasis and psoriatic arthritis. Genomic loci with pleiotropic effects on coronary artery calcification
Atherosclerosis, 2006We measured 381 genomewide markers and performed genetic linkage analyses in search of loci influencing coronary artery calcification (CAC), a measure of atherosclerosis determined by electron beam computed tomography, in 948 non-Hispanic white siblings (mean age [+/-standard deviation] = 59.6 +/- 9.9 years; 73.7% hypertensive).
